Sept. 7, 2022 52nd FW first in AF to upgrade F-16s with AESA radar systems The AESA upgrade provides F-16s enhancement in combat capabilities, improving pilot effectiveness, air defenses and overall aircraft survivability when faced by enemy forces.

May 18, 2021 Air Force opens new F-16 production line for foreign military sales To support the growing demand for new F-16 Fighting Falcon from partner nations, the U.S. Air Force has teamed with Lockheed Martin Corp. to open a new production line to build the F-16 Block 70/72 fighter aircraft at the company’s facility in Greenville, South Carolina.
